You can withdraw FIAT by sending your Crypto to the ATM Provided address, wait for confirmations, and receive the cash.

Some ATM companies require KYC, so you need to have your phone ready, and ID.

There is one crypto ATM at the mall Galleria Tbilisi (Rustaveli Str. 2/4). This photo is from July this year.
If I remember correctly, the ATM is situated on the street level, next to escalators.
